Blame the Brain: Why Psychopaths Lack Empathy

Tuesday, September 24, 2013 - 15:30 in Psychology & Sociology

When people with psychopathy imagine others experiencing pain, brain regions associated with empathy and concern for others fail to activate or connect with brain areas involved in emotional processing and decision-making.
